Pairing Rathskeller with Other Fonts
While Rathskeller shines as a headline or logo font, pairing it with a complementary typeface can enhance your overall design. Here are a few simple font pairing ideas:
- Pair with a clean sans serif: Use a simple font like Helvetica or Open Sans for body text to keep the design modern and easy to read.
- Combine with a readable serif: For a more classic or elegant look, pair Rathskeller with a serif font like Georgia or Merriweather.
- Use with a script font for contrast: If you want to add a personal or handcrafted touch, use a script font like Great Vibes for accents or subheadings.
These combinations help create visual hierarchy while keeping your brand identity strong and cohesive.
Understanding Font Licensing for Business Use
Before using Rathskeller on your products, packaging, or digital assets, make sure you have the proper commercial license. Many fonts are free for personal use but require a paid license for business applications like merchandise, templates, or client work.
Always check the font’s license agreement to ensure you’re using it legally. This is especially important if you're selling products or offering branded templates to your customers.
Final Tips for Using Rathskeller Effectively
Here are a few final tips to help you get the most out of Rathskeller:
- Use it sparingly: Since it’s a display font, it works best for headlines, logos, and short text rather than long paragraphs.
- Stick to brand colors: Pair Rathskeller with your brand’s color palette to reinforce visual recognition.
- Maintain consistency: Use the same font weight and style across all materials to keep your brand look unified.
- Stay updated: Some font creators release new weights or variations—check for updates to keep your design fresh.
